The Darkness Inside (Original Poem)
In the darkness of the human soul,
Lies a depth that's hard to control.
A place where light doesn't seem to touch,
And pain and fear demand so much.
Each heart holds stories left untold,
Of tragedies and horrors unfold.
Emotions writhing, seeking release,
Aching to find some inner peace.
For in the shadows we try to hide,
Our deepest fears that often collide.
We paint on smiles and wear masks all day,
Just to make it through in our own way.
The sorrow echoes like a silent scream,
As we battle demons inside unseen.
And yet, amidst this endless night,
There shines a tiny spark of light.
Hope flickers - faint but true,
Whispering of peace anew.
Where scars will heal and darkness fade,
Into warmth, love, and bright arcade.
We are not just made of despair and woe,
But also love, kindness, goodwill show.
Though the darkness may linger on for life's span,
With strength, we can be whole again.
